Master Johnson Master Ernie Johnson studied Tae Kwon Do in Korea and Thailand during the Viet Nam War.  He received his 1st Dan in the Song Moo Kwan school of Tae Kwon Do in August of 1971.  Master Johnson continued his training in the United States with several systems until he met Grandmaster Pak.  Starting as a brown belt with Moo Duk Kwon - Tang Soo Do, Master Johnson became Grandmaster Pak's #66 black belt in 1981.  Master Johnson began teaching in 1984 in Switzerland, Florida and moved his school to Mandarin in 1986.  Master Johnson tested for his 7th Dan in July 2006. Master Nathan Master Nathan Alexander (6th Dan) began his martial arts journey in 1984 under the instruction of 7th Dan Master Johnson.  By 1987 he earned his 1st Dan Black Belt at the age of 10.  Once he accomplished his goal of earning a Black Belt, Master Johnson taught taught that your Black Belt is just the beginning and began training him for his future Dan tests with Master's rank as his long term goal.  Master Johnson instilled in him that to become a Master -- one must become a Master of learning and teaching.  In May of 1995, he earned his Master's rank.
